Penang Itinerary

2026-10-15 Β· 3 Days Β· AI-Generated
Day 1|Heritage & Art Exploration
Step back in time as you navigate the narrow lanes of George Town, where colonial architecture meets vibrant contemporary art. The city hums with a mix of Chinese, Indian, and Malay influences, creating a sensory overload of sights and smells. Spend your day wandering through shophouses and historic clan jetties that define the island's soul.
πŸŒ… Morning09:00 - Heritage Walk
Explore the UNESCO World Heritage core, visiting the Khoo Kongsi clan house and the vibrant street art murals.
β˜€οΈ Afternoon14:00 - Peranakan Culture
Visit the Pinang Peranakan Mansion to witness the rich history of the Straits Chinese community.
πŸŒ™ Evening19:00 - Hawker Food Trail
Dine at Chulia Street or New Lane to sample authentic Char Kway Teow and Cendol.

Day 2|Spiritual Heights & Panoramic Views
Head inland to the hills of Air Itam, home to Malaysia's largest Buddhist temple and the island's highest peak. The contrast between the intricate temple carvings and the sweeping views from the summit offers a serene escape from the city heat. This day is dedicated to spiritual discovery and capturing the best vistas in Penang.
Day 3|Coastal Relaxation & Departure
Conclude your trip with a relaxing morning on the golden sands of Batu Ferringhi. Enjoy the coastal breeze, indulge in a spa treatment, or simply watch the waves before your flight. The laid-back beach vibe is the perfect antidote to the bustling energy of the city, ensuring you leave refreshed.

Best Time to Visit

The best time to visit Penang is between November and February when the weather is relatively dry and cool, making it perfect for walking through the heritage zones. Avoid the peak monsoon season in October if possible, though showers are usually short and refreshing.

How to Reach

✈️ By AirDirect flights operate daily from Singapore Changi Airport (SIN) to Penang International Airport (PEN) via Singapore Airlines, AirAsia, or Jetstar, taking approximately 1 hour and 20 minutes.
πŸš† By TrainTravel via KTM ETS train from KL Sentral to Butterworth Station, followed by a 15-minute ferry ride to George Town.
🚌 By RoadDrive via the North-South Expressway (E1) from Kuala Lumpur to Penang Bridge, approximately a 4-5 hour drive.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is Penang safe for tourists?

Yes, Penang is generally very safe, though standard precautions against petty theft in crowded tourist areas are advised.

Do I need a visa?

Singaporeans and many international travelers enjoy visa-free entry to Malaysia for short stays; check your specific nationality requirements.

What is the best way to get around?

George Town is best explored on foot, while Grab is the most reliable way to reach attractions like Penang Hill or Kek Lok Si.
